Jerry Gonzalez & the Fort Apache Band

Rhumba Buhaina

2005-12-03

Originally a member of Dizzy Gillespie’s band, Gonzalez has played trumpet and flugelhorn with many bands as well as having produced over ten of his own albums since the late 1970s. In this recording, his Cuban roots put a new spin on the music of Art Blakey and the Jazz Messengers.
